Output 592096c122fc90aec24fcf0f2bde4030bf6d81a0bf73fec7f2f2f931b521c38f:1

value
3022886
script pubkey
OP_0 OP_PUSHBYTES_20 dab2c413508fdbae855e2bcfb0c47caf59d291b3
address
ltc1qm2evgy6s3ld6ap27908mp3ru4ava9ydns07k9l
transaction
592096c122fc90aec24fcf0f2bde4030bf6d81a0bf73fec7f2f2f931b521c38f
spent
true